Как узнать количество аргументов, переданных сценарию Bash?

Как узнать количество аргументов, переданных сценарию Bash?

Вот что у меня есть сейчас:

#!/bin/bash
i=0
for var in "$@"
do
  i=i+1
done

Есть ли другие (лучшие) способы делаете это?

168
задан Zuul 11 July 2012 в 22:06
поделиться